OFFICIAL LEGAL TITLE
Expressing support for shipping on the Great Lakes and the potential for international container ship commerce.
F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
What is the official ID of this bill?
The official print number for this legislation is 117_HRES_818.
Which chamber initiated this legislation?
This legislation was initiated in the House of Representatives.
When did the legislative process begin?
The process officially started on 2021-11-18.
What are the main provisions?
Key points include:
- Supports reducing congestion at high-volume coastal ports and expanding options for importing and exporting goods.
- Supports the potential for more international container ship traffic through the Saint Lawrence Seaway and Great Lakes ports.
- Expresses support for Great Lakes and inland waterway ports and their current and future role in international trade commerce.
What is the specific legal status?
The current status is Expired.

Who is the primary sponsor?
The primary sponsor is Rep. Stauber, Pete [R-MN-8].
What is the latest detailed status?
The latest detailed status is: Referred to the Subcommittee on Trade.
